#d358b5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d358b5 is composed of 82.7% red, 34.5% green and 71%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.3% magenta, 14.2%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 314.6 degrees, a saturation of 58.3% and a lightness of 58.6%. #d358b5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b0ff with #a7006b.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#d358b5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d358b5 has RGB values of R:211, G:88, B:181 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.58, Y:0.14,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13850805.
